The Immense Scale of the Problem: Rolex Imitaciones Perfectas

The proliferation of "Rolex imitaciones perfectas" (perfect Rolex imitations) highlights the sophisticated nature of the counterfeiting industry. These aren't your grandfather's cheap knock-offs. Modern counterfeiters employ advanced techniques, using high-quality materials and meticulous craftsmanship to create replicas that can fool even experienced eyes. The price range of these imitations varies drastically, from relatively inexpensive copies to incredibly convincing super-replicas that command surprisingly high prices. This makes the authentication process even more critical. Understanding the subtle differences between a genuine Rolex and a high-quality replica can save you thousands, if not tens of thousands, of dollars.

Key Areas to Examine: Como Identificar Una Rolex Original

Authenticating a Rolex requires a meticulous examination of several key areas. This isn't a quick process; it demands patience and attention to detail. Let's break down the crucial aspects:

1. The Case and Bracelet:

* Materials: Genuine Rolex watches utilize high-quality materials like 904L stainless steel (known for its corrosion resistance), 18k gold, or platinum. Counterfeits often use cheaper alternatives, which may exhibit a different color, sheen, or weight. Pay close attention to the feel and heft of the watch; a genuine Rolex feels substantial and solid.

* Finish: Rolex employs meticulous finishing techniques, resulting in a smooth, consistent surface with a distinct gleam. Counterfeits often lack this precision, exhibiting imperfections, inconsistencies in the brushing or polishing, or a duller appearance.

* Hallmarks and Markings: Genuine Rolex cases and bracelets are engraved with specific markings, including the Rolex crown logo, model number, and serial number. These markings should be crisp, deeply engraved, and perfectly aligned. Counterfeit markings are often shallow, uneven, or poorly aligned.

* Clasp: The clasp mechanism on a genuine Rolex is smooth, precise, and secure. It should close with a satisfying click and feel robust. Counterfeit clasps often feel flimsy, loose, or exhibit poor construction.

2. The Dial and Hands:

* Lume: Genuine Rolex watches utilize Super-LumiNova or similar high-quality luminescent material. The lume should be evenly applied and emit a consistent, bright glow in low-light conditions. Counterfeit lume is often unevenly applied, glows weakly, or has a different color than authentic Rolex lume.
